Understanding Digital Transformation in the Modern Context
Digital transformation refers to the integration of digital technologies into all areas of a business, fundamentally changing how organisations operate and deliver value to customers. However, it is not simply about adopting new software or automating a few processes. True digital transformation involves rethinking business models, improving organisational culture, and using data intelligently to drive decisions.
In the modern context, digital transformation is about agility, innovation, and customer-centricity. Businesses must be able to respond quickly to market changes, leverage emerging technologies, and deliver seamless experiences across digital channels. This holistic approach is what separates organisations that merely digitise from those that truly transform.
